This stirring documentary from Hollywood director Frank Capra is one of the films in the WW2 series Why We Fight!, which were made to explain the conflict (then ongoing) to American audiences. The Battle of Russia, made in 1943, when Capra, who joined the Forces, along with many other movie people, was a Lieutenant Colonel, has many amazing real-life battle scenes: when a soldier goes down he's not acting, it's for real. Anyone remotely interested in WW2 - or Russia - will be fascinated.
